Abstract

There are significant disparities in the timing of brachial plexus surgery. These relate to timing rather than receipt of nerve repair; socioeconomically advantaged individuals with private insurance in the higher income quartiles are more likely to undergo surgery in the elective setting and have a supported discharge.
